Company Info
Mid sized business
1 to 50 Employees
Flex Finance is Africa's leading Spend management and requisition platform that helps finance teams and business owners manage all company spending in one place.
Flex Finance is Africa’s leading Spend management and requisition platform that helps finance teams and business owners manage all company spending in one place. We combined robust payment infrastructure with spend management architecture and data-rich expense reports to revolutionize how African businesses track spending.
Job Title: Quality Assurance Engineer
Location: Nigeria
Employment Type: Full Time
Role Overview
- We are looking for a detail-oriented Quality Assurance (QA) Engineer to join our team.
- In this role, you will be responsible for testing our products, identifying bugs, and ensuring the highest level of software quality.
- You will work closely with developers, product managers, and designers to deliver a flawless user experience.
Key Responsibilities
Testing & Quality Assurance:
- Developed, executed, and maintained manual and automated test cases for web and mobile applications.
- Identify, document, and track software bugs and defects using a bug-tracking system.
- Perform functional, regression, performance, and security testing to ensure product stability.
Collaboration & Process Improvement:
- Work closely with developers and product teams to understand requirements and test cases.
- Ensure early detection of bugs by implementing test-driven development (TDD) and continuous testing strategies.
- Provide feedback on software usability and suggest improvements.
Automation & Performance Testing:
- Write and maintain automated test scripts using tools like Selenium, Cypress, or Appium.
- Conduct API testing using Postman or similar tools.
- Analyze test results and work with the development team to resolve issues.
Requirements
Qualification, Technical Skills & Experience:
- Bachelor’s degree in Computer Science, Software Engineering, or a related field.
- 2+ years of experience in software testing and quality assurance.
- Strong knowledge of QA methodologies, tools, and best practices.
- Hands-on experience with manual and automated testing for web and mobile applications.
- Proficiency in test automation tools (e.g., Selenium, Cypress, Appium).
- Experience with API testing (Postman, REST Assured) and performance testing tools (JMeter).
Soft Skills & Attributes:
- Excellent analytical and problem-solving skills.
- Strong attention to detail and a passion for product quality.
- Ability to work in a fast-paced, agile environment.
- Effective communication skills and a team-player mindset.
Nice-to-Have Skills:
- Experience in fintech or payment systems.
- Familiarity with CI/CD pipelines and DevOps practices.
- Scripting knowledge (Python, Java, JavaScript) for test automation.
What We Offer
- A dynamic, innovative fintech environment
- Competitive salary & benefits package
- Hybrid work flexibility
- Opportunities for career growth and skill development
Application Closing Date
Not Specified
How to Apply: Interested and qualified candidates should send their CV to: [email protected] using the Job Title as the subject of the mail.